I also wanted to used designs and textures that reminded me of Celtic patterns so I got out the Swirls & Curls Embossing Folder from the Holiday Catalogue (still available to order) and the new Painted Seasons Designer Series Paper which is only available until the end of March, and the Amazing Life stamp set, and got to work!



  • I went back to an old technique for the background called Faux Patina that you apply to a dry embossed panel. First you sponge the surface with various colours of darker ink. Here I only used Soft Suede, as I wanted the overall impression to be left with the Shaded Spruce I started with. Then you lightly rub Versamark ink over the surface, highlighting a few raised areas, but not heavily. (It's a good idea, before doing this to make sure the sponged ink is thoroughly dry and use the Embossing Buddy as well.) Then you sprinkle on the Gold Stampin' Emboss Powder, really tapping and brushing off the excess. Then you heat set the embossing powder.
  • One of the designs in the Painted Seasons Designer Series Paper has this cool Celtic looking pattern in Call Me Clover. I added a little Gold Embossing Powder around the edges.
  • The sentiment and the shamrock are from the Amazing Life stamp set. I stamped the sentiment in Shaded Spruce and the shamrock in both Call Me Clover and Versamark covered with Gold Embossing Powder and heat set.
  • The two stitched circles are die cut using the Stitched Shapes Framelits. The one with the framelit has Gold Metallic Thread looped on the back and Gold Faceted Gems on the front.

I'm working on Birthday Card designs right now and I randomly pulled Mango Melody cardstock out, thinking that it would be a lively colour to pair with the Amazing Life stamp set, which I needed to ink up for the first time. Then I tried to find DSP and other colours to match up with it and wow! That colour is not easy to match. Well, not if you are not a fan of the complementary colours that Stampin' Up! often pairs. I'm much more of an analogous colour person where I will choose colours much closer to each other on the colour wheel with the same undertones, along with neutrals and they somehow have to kind of 'glow' together! It's an instinct for me, but I really struggled with Mango Melody. The best match for me was Calypso Coral but it needed an intermediary colour so I used So Saffron, with Crumb Cake as a neutral.



Without a proper DSP to match these colours, I needed lots of texture for my backgrounds, so I settled on the Ruffled Dynamic Embossing Folder for the Calypso Coral panel and the Corrugated Dynamic Embossing Folder for the Crumb Cake strip. For both of these pieces, I lightly spritzed the paper first with water so that I could get the deep impression without the paper cracking, especially in the case of the Corrugated Folder.
